Measuring the gravitational constant in a university laboratory
N. S. Stepanov, A. V. Shisharin National Research Lobachevsky State University of Nizhny Novgorod
Abstract:
A setup for measuring gravitational constant in a university laboratory is described. The setup includes a torsion pendulum which swings under the action of gravitational attraction from test masses whose positions are made to change periodically in phase with pendulum oscillations by a special device. The gravity constant is calculated from the amplitude of steady-state oscillations. The experimental and calculation procedure is described and measurement errors are estimated.
